You need to drag a file with authority to break through, not an easy task with the MacBook Pro’s trackpad. The first few times I tried to copy files from a remote computer to my MacBook Pro, I found that my file halted abruptly at the border of the remote window. This works well once you get the hang of the resistance encountered when moving from the remote computer’s boundaries to your master computer. Version 3 has added Remote Drag and Drop and Remote Copy and Paste functions, so you can now copy remote files by simply dragging them to and from the remote window. In Apple Remote Desktop 2, you could only copy files to a remote computer it was a one-way street. Last version ( ) was powerful, many of Apple Remote Desktop 3’s new features are astounding.
